Integrity in Research Policy

The Integrity in Research Policy ensures, that the University community understands and practices the highest standards of integrity in pursuing scholarly research. This policy has recently under went a reveiw consistant with the One-Year policy Reivew Plan.

It is imporant that the policy be consistant with the Tri-Agency Framework: Responsible Conduct in Research (2021) where possible.

One of the biggest ammendments to the policy is allowing for anonymous reporting if accompanied by sufficient information to enable the assessment of the allegation and the credibility of the facts and evidence on which the allegation is based, without the need for further information from the complainant.
